The gCenter dashboard is Granulate's tool for visually tracking, analyzing, and displaying key performance and cost metrics, which enable you to monitor the benefits provided by Granulate's real-time continuous optimization.
The gCenter provides you quick access to metrics and summary data over all optimized clusters, as well as individual data for each service in your Granulate account. You can obtain an overview of your current performance improvement, cost reduction benefits and insights for potential savings across clusters optimized by Granulate.
Check out our in-depth tutorial video for the gCenter
In the main menu of Granulate console, click on Overview. The gCenter overview dashboard includes the following main areas:
The summary panel provides insights into the cost reduction benefit and performance improvements across all optimized services.
Cost reduction: The cost reduction section shows the compute spend saved due to Granulate's optimization as well as the actual spend across all optimized services vs. the projected spend without Granulate. The cost reduction data is aggregated based on the time filter selected.
Performance status: The performance status section shows the improved performance benefits achieved due to Granulate's performance optimization for the metrics collected.
This panel provides insights into the deployment status of Granulate agents across the optimized services. This section shows the distribution of active agents that are optimizing performance, along with any passive agents which are in learning mode.
The resource map provides a graphical overview of all the services optimized by Granulate. The services are grouped based on the relevant service name. The color of the different services changes to reflect the service's health.
Clicking on a specific Granulate optimized service will provide visual details regarding its deployment status, performance improvement, and cost reduction benefits.
In the main menu of the Granulate console, click on Services. The gCenter services dashboard includes the following main areas:
Instances / Pods table view
The summary panel provides insights into the cost reduction benefit, performance improvement metrics, and deployment status of the agents on the specific service.
Cost reduction: The cost-reduction section shows the compute spend saved due to Granulate's optimization as well as the actual spend for the specific service. This section also shows the actual compute spend vs. the projected spend without Granulate. The cost reduction data is aggregated based on the time filter selected.
Performance status: The performance status section shows the improved performance benefits achieved due to Granulate's performance optimization for the main metrics collected. The section also shows the actual performance metrics vs. the projected performance metrics without Granulate. The data is aggregated based on the time filter selected.
Deployment status: The deployment status section shows the number of installed agents on the selected service as well as the number of active agents vs. passive agents.
The metrics overview section shows the performance metrics of the specific service based on the aggregated time frame. By default, the main metrics shown are the following:
Number of cores
Number of instances
Average number of requests per second
Average CPU utilization
Instances / Pods View
The instances / Pods view provides an in-depth table-view of the optimized instances and Kubernetes Pods. This view allows you to analyze the performance status of each instance / pod and to control the deployed Granulate agents.
The in-depth view allows you to search and filter based on instance/pod name, instance type, instance life-cycle IP address, latency, throughput, CPU utilization, agent health, agent status, and agent version.